Benefits of a UK subsidiary

Establishing a UK subsidiary is a strategic way to grow your business internationally while managing risk effectively. It allows your company to build a presence in the UK market, access local talent, and operate with greater flexibility, all while maintaining a degree of separation from your parent company.

From a legal standpoint, a subsidiary is a distinct entity. This means that while the parent company retains overall control, liabilities such as employment disputes or contractual issues typically rest with the subsidiary, not the parent. This structure helps limit exposure and protect your core business.

At the same time, a UK subsidiary can develop its own identity, with a culture, brand, and management style tailored to the local market. This independence can be a real asset when navigating the nuances of doing business in the UK.
